A Minute on Series Vs Stand-alones. This is definitely a me-thing and I suppose a slightly weird angle to have a take on. I love reading stories. All stories. As many stories as I can and if you have been following for a while, you will know my all time favourites are Contemporary Romances. Now, it is quite common to have series, where different interconnected characters will all have their romances across a number of books, usually 3-6 . The biggest series that I have come across so far is 10 books. And that's great, so much world building and shared in-jokes. A good book series can be like a warm hug from an old friend. But it can also be exhausting keeping up! If you have to draw a family tree just so you can keep a track of which character has come from where, that feels like a lot of work. Similarly, if you can't follow the story because there's an ocean of cameos and call backs, that can also be a little bit off putting! Now, I would never presume to tell authors how to go about their work, I am grateful for their work. Nor is this really a criticism of series, I love a good series. No this is more a humble plea for more standalone novels. A self -contained read is a wonderful thing and I think all of us have a favourite story that was just perfect from start to finish, and needed nothing more! What do you think? Does it matter?
